Development of a methodology for calibrating and validating the stand for testing optoelectronic protective equipment

Project manager: Tomasz Strawiński M.Sc. (Eng.)

Project summary:

The aim of the task was to develop a methodology, tools and procedures for that would make it possible to calibrate the stand on one's own and that would make it possible to maintain the required measurement traceability.The following were developed and carried out within the framework of the task: - a methodology for calibrating the stand for testing optoelectronic protective equipment,- tools for carrying out the developed methodology,- a measurement procedure PWS/NB2-01 for calibrating/checking the stand for testing optoelectronic protective equipment,- a calculation formula for estimating the measurement uncertainty of results,- an instruction for ascertaining the calibration and measurement uncertainty of response time for the stand for measuring response time of optoelectric protective equipment,- calibration of the stand and estimation of the calibration uncertainty in accordance with the developed measurement procedure and instruction for ascertaining uncertainty,- validation of the stand for measuring response time of optoelectric protective equipment according to the selected testing procedure and measurements uncertainty assessment.
